      $MicroSectors Gold Miners 3x Leveraged ETN(GDXU)$ $Invesco QQQ(QQQ)$  $Materials Select Sector SPDR Fund(XLB)$ One day up 0.73%, the next up 5.33%. Same rules, same portfolio, no intervention. This is what concentrated trend following actually feels like. The volatility cuts both ways. If you trim every winner because the ride feels uncomfortable, you also remove the possibility that one trend becomes large enough to carry the book.
